- The distance between Port Arthur, Tx, Usa and Padidan, Pakistan is approximately 13,420 km or 8,339 mi.
- To reach Port Arthur, Tx in this distance one would set out from Padidan bearing 342°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Port Arthur, Tx bearing 198.5° or SSW .
- Port Arthur, Tx has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Padidan has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
- Port Arthur, Tx is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Padidan is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 6.2 °C (11.2°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4 °C (7.2°F) less in Port Arthur, Tx.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1344.1 mm (52.9 in) more which is equivalent to 1344.1 l/m² (32.99 US gal/ft²) or 13,441,000 l/ha (1,436,932 US gal/ac) more. About 13 2/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 3.1° lower in Port Arthur, Tx than in Padidan.
